I've been watching the Eagles play since Randall Cunnigham lead an offense featuring Herschel Walker, Mike Quick and Keith Jackson. And Jerome Brown, Reggie White, Clyde Simmons and Eric Allen were shutting down offenses.

My memory of the Eagles goes back a while. Long enough to know that Philly fans, they eat their own.

With that in mind should the Eagles retain Donovan McNabb? The franchise has made seven playoff appearances in the last nine years, has played in five or six conference championships and appeared in a Superbowl -- largely thanks to McNabb's leadership.

On the other side, his detractors say "he can't win the big one". The same thing that haunted John Elway until the end of his career and Dan Marino his whole stint in the NFL.

So, is it time for Philly to move on and implode the Eagles or retain McNabb and build a better team around him, in anticipation of at least another five to seven good years?
